摘要:
介绍 冒泡排序是一种简单的排序算法。它重复地走访过要排序的数列,一次比较两个元素,如果它们的顺序错误就把它们交换过来。 走访数列的工作是重复地进行直到没有再需要交换,也就是说该数列已经排序完成。这个算法的名字由来是因为越小的元素会经由交换慢慢“浮”到数列的顶端。 算法描述 比较相邻的元素。如果第一个 阅读全文
摘要:
为什么要分区和分表 我们的数据库数据越来越大,随之而来的是单个表中数据太多,以至于查询速度过慢,而且由于表的锁机制导致应用操作也受到严重影响,出现数据库性能瓶颈。 MySQL中有一种机制是表锁定和行锁定,是为了保证数据的完整性。表锁定表示你们都不能对这张表进行操作,必须等我对表操作完才行。行锁定也一 阅读全文
摘要:
用户模块 用户登录表(customer_login) CREATE TABLE customer_login( customer_id INT UNSIGNED AUTO_INCREMENT NOT NULL COMMENT '用户ID', login_name VARCHAR(20) NOT NU 阅读全文
摘要:
前言 一个商城系统,需要有,用户表,商品表,商品分类表,购物车表,订单表,订单明细表,支付信息表,以及物流信息表。 使用PowerDesigner对数据表以及他们之间的关系进行了粗略的设计得出了如下E-R图: 1.用户表 2. 商品表 3.商品类别表 4.购物车表 5. 订单表 6.订单明细表 7. 阅读全文
摘要:
前言 一个成功的管理系统,是由:[50% 的业务 + 50% 的软件] 所组成,而 50% 的成功软件又有 [25% 的数据库 + 25% 的程序] 所组成,数据库设计的好坏是一个关键。如果把企业的数据比做生命所必需的血液,那么数据库的设计就是应用中最重要的一部分。 有关数据库设计的材料汗牛充栋,大 阅读全文
摘要:
如果需要开发FTP文件上传下载功能,那么需要在本机上搭建一个本地FTP服务器,方便调试 第一步:配置IIS Web服务器 1.1 控制面板中找到“程序”并打开 1.2 程序界面找到“启用或关闭Windows功能”并打开 1.3 上面两步也可以简化为一步:按【Win + R】快捷键打开运行对话框,输入 阅读全文
摘要:
简介 OpenResty是一个基于Nginx与Lua的高性能Web平台,其内部集成了大量精良的Lua库、第三方模块以及大多数的依赖项。用于方便地搭建能够处理超高并发、扩展性极高的动态Web应用、Web服务和动态网关。 OpenResty通过汇聚各种设计精良的Nginx模块(主要由OpenResty团 阅读全文
摘要:
出错场景 搭建完Eureka后,启动类,进行验证,结果出现如下错误 检查配置,类没有什么问题,想到版本冲突。如上图蓝色框包裹的,热部署相关的包。 原因: 因为版本较高,可能与SpringCloud冲突,所有我就降低了版本 解决: 改为2.1.2后,再次启动,就没问题了!!! 阅读全文
摘要:
下载安装 1.下载lua包并解压 wget -c http://www.lua.org/ftp/lua-5.3.5.tar.gztar zxvf lua-5.3.5.tar.gz 2.下载libreadline相关支持 yum -y install libreadline5 libreadline- 阅读全文
摘要:
使用Docker安装FastDFS Linux环境 1. 获取镜像 下载: docker image pull delron/fastdfs 加载好镜像后,就可以开启运行FastDFS的tracker和storage了。 2. 运行tracker 执行如下命令开启tracker 服务 docker 阅读全文